Suddenly there is no sound in the speaker but headphone works fine..laptop is Lenovo B575

If the head phone jack works its more likely to be the problem, if you use the headphone jack a lot the connections inside it can get worn or bent out of shape--engaging the headphone jack should shut the speakers in the unit off.

Other possible reason is a bad speaker or connections.

My lenovo y510 power is sometime not working.

Check the DC Power Jack where the Power Cord Plugs into the laptop.

Maybe your DC Power Jack which is where the power cord plugsinto the computer is bad. Take an ink pen and push the tip inside thejack and see if the little pin wiggles, if so the jack is bad. You'll have totake the laptop apart to fix it. Most times it is soldered onto themotherboard, so you will have to desolder the old and solder a new one.
